Muon g$-$2 in two-Higgs-doublet models
Abstract
Updating various theoretical and experimental constraints on the four different types of two-Higgs-doublet models (2HDMs), we find that only the ``lepton-specific" (or ``type X") 2HDM can explain the present muon g$-$2 anomaly in the parameter region of large $\tanβ$, a light CP-odd boson, and heavier CP-even and charged bosons which are almost degenerate. The severe constraints on the models come mainly from the consideration of vacuum stability and perturbativity, the electroweak precision data, the $b$-quark observables like $B_S \to μμ$, the precision measurements of the lepton universality as well as the 125 GeV boson property observed at the LHC.
